数控车槽的手编程主要包括以下步骤:
了解数控系统的编程格式和指令集
不同的数控系统有不同的编程格式,常见的有G代码和M代码。
G代码用于控制数控系统的运动轨迹,如直线插补、圆弧插补等。
M代码用于控制辅助功能,如切削液的开关、主轴的启停等。
明确切槽的加工要求
包括切槽的尺寸、深度、切削速度等参数。
根据加工要求,选择合适的切削工具和切削条件。
编写加工程序
根据加工要求和数控系统的编程格式,手动输入G代码和M代码来编写切槽程序。
确定切槽的起点和终点位置,可以使用G代码中的G00或G01指令控制刀具的直线插补运动。
根据切槽的宽度和深度,使用G代码中的G41或G42指令选择刀具的半径补偿。
根据需要,使用M代码控制辅助功能。
程序的验证和调试
可以通过数控系统的模拟功能,模拟切削过程,检查切槽路径和切削结果是否符合要求。
如果需要调整,可以根据实际情况进行修改。
示例程序
```
N10 G90 G54 ; 绝对坐标,参考坐标系
N20 S1000 M03 ; 设置主轴转速为1000转/分钟,主轴正转
N30 M08 ; 冷却液开
N40 G00 X10 Y10 ; 快速定位到X10 Y10位置
N50 G01 Z-5 F100 ; 沿Z轴下行5mm,进给速度100mm/min
N60 G02 X20 Y20 I5 J0 F100 ; 以X轴正方向为起点,逆时针绘制半径为5mm的圆弧,进给速度100mm/min
N70 G01 Z-10 F200 ; 沿Z轴下行10mm,进给速度200mm/min
N80 G01 X30 Y30 F200 ; 沿X轴正方向移动至X30 Y30位置,进给速度200mm/min
N90 G03 X40 Y40 I5 J0 F200 ; 以X轴正方向为起点,顺时针绘制半径为5mm的圆弧,进给速度200mm/min
N100 G01
```
注意事项
在编写程序时,确保所有指令和参数正确无误,以避免加工过程中的错误。
在实际加工前,务必进行充分的程序调试,确保程序的正确性和安全性。
加工过程中要密切观察切削状态和加工质量,及时进行调整和干预。
通过以上步骤和示例代码,可以完成数控车槽的手编程。掌握数控系统的编程格式和指令集,明确加工要求,按照规定的格式和指令编写程序,验证和调试程序,是实现高效、精确的切槽加工的关键。